Dodge OBD2 P0340: Camshaft Position Sensor Circuit Malfunction

The dreaded P0340 code. If you’re a Dodge owner, seeing this dodge obd2 p0340 code pop up on your OBD2 scanner can be a real headache. This code indicates a problem with the camshaft position sensor circuit, a critical component for your engine’s performance. This article will dive deep into the p0340 code, specifically for Dodge vehicles, exploring its causes, symptoms, diagnostic procedures, and solutions.

Understanding the P0340 Code

The P0340 code stands for “Camshaft Position Sensor “A” Circuit Malfunction.” The camshaft position sensor tells the engine control module (ECM) the position of the camshaft, which is essential for timing the fuel injection and ignition. A malfunctioning circuit can disrupt this timing, leading to a variety of performance issues. This is particularly true in Dodge vehicles, which are known for their powerful engines that rely heavily on precise timing.

p0340 error codes for obd2 2004 dodge ram 1500

What Causes a P0340 Code in a Dodge?

Several factors can trigger a P0340 code in your Dodge. These can range from simple electrical issues to more complex mechanical problems. Some of the most common causes include:

  • Wiring Problems: Damaged, corroded, or loose wiring in the camshaft position sensor circuit is a frequent culprit.
  • Faulty Camshaft Position Sensor: The sensor itself can fail due to age, wear, or exposure to extreme temperatures.
  • Timing Chain/Belt Issues: A stretched or broken timing chain or belt can disrupt the synchronization between the crankshaft and camshaft, affecting the sensor readings.
  • Damaged Connector: The connector that attaches the sensor to the wiring harness can become damaged or corroded.
  • Low Oil Pressure: Inadequate oil pressure can affect the operation of the sensor, especially in engines with variable valve timing.

Symptoms of a P0340 Code

The symptoms of a P0340 code can vary depending on the severity of the problem and the specific Dodge model. Common symptoms include:

  • Check Engine Light: The most obvious symptom is the illumination of the check engine light on your dashboard.
  • Rough Idle: The engine may idle roughly or stall.
  • Reduced Performance: You might experience a loss of power or acceleration.
  • Difficulty Starting: The engine may crank but not start, or it may take longer than usual to start.
  • Poor Fuel Economy: A malfunctioning camshaft position sensor can lead to decreased fuel efficiency.

dodge obd2 code p0340

Diagnosing a P0340 Code

Diagnosing a P0340 code requires a systematic approach. Here’s a general procedure:

  1. Retrieve the Code: Use an OBD2 scanner to confirm the P0340 code.
  2. Visually Inspect: Check the wiring harness and connector for damage, corrosion, or loose connections.
  3. Test the Sensor: Use a multimeter to test the sensor’s resistance and voltage.
  4. Check the Timing Chain/Belt: Inspect the timing chain or belt for wear, stretching, or damage.

“A thorough diagnosis is crucial,” says automotive expert John Smith, ASE Certified Master Technician. “Don’t just throw parts at the problem. Take the time to identify the root cause.”

obd2 codes 2005 dodge ram 1500 5.7 l hemi

Fixing a P0340 Code

Once you’ve diagnosed the cause of the P0340 code, you can take the appropriate steps to fix it. This might involve:

  • Repairing or Replacing Wiring: Fix any damaged or corroded wiring, or replace the entire wiring harness if necessary.
  • Replacing the Camshaft Position Sensor: If the sensor is faulty, replace it with a new one.
  • Replacing the Timing Chain/Belt: If the timing chain or belt is worn or damaged, replace it.
  • Repairing or Replacing the Connector: If the connector is damaged, repair or replace it.

using obd2 1998 dodge ram wont start

Conclusion: Taking Control of Your Dodge’s P0340 Code

Addressing the dodge obd2 p0340 code promptly is essential for maintaining your Dodge’s performance and preventing further engine damage. By understanding the causes, symptoms, and diagnostic procedures, you can take control of the situation and get your Dodge back on the road.

FAQ

  1. Can I drive my Dodge with a P0340 code? It’s not recommended to drive extensively with a P0340 code, as it can lead to further damage.
  2. How much does it cost to fix a P0340 code? The cost can vary depending on the cause and the specific Dodge model, but it can range from a few hundred to over a thousand dollars.
  3. Is the P0340 code the same for all Dodge models? While the code itself refers to the same issue, the specific causes and solutions can vary slightly between models.
  4. Can I fix a P0340 code myself? If you have some mechanical experience, you might be able to fix some of the simpler causes, like wiring issues. However, more complex problems may require professional assistance.
  5. What is the difference between the camshaft and crankshaft position sensors? The camshaft position sensor monitors the camshaft’s position, while the crankshaft position sensor monitors the crankshaft’s position. Both are crucial for engine timing.

“Ignoring the P0340 code can lead to costly repairs down the line,” warns automotive specialist Sarah Jones, owner of Jones Auto Repair. “Addressing it promptly is always the best course of action.”

obd2 scanner for ram 1500

Need help? Contact us via WhatsApp: +1(641)206-8880, Email: [email protected] or visit us at 789 Elm Street, San Francisco, CA 94102, USA. Our customer support team is available 24/7.

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*